ANNAPOLIS, Md. (AP) - Prince George's County Executive Jack Johnson and his wife, who was recently elected to the County Council, have been charged in federal court with tampering with a witness and evidence relating to a federal offense.
Johnson and his wife, Leslie, were taken into custody on Friday. Both had an initial appearance in U.S. District Court on Friday afternoon.
According to a federal affidavit, they also have been charged with aiding and abetting.
Maryland U.S. Attorney Rod Rosenstein, FBI Special Agent in Charge Richard A. McFeely and Rebecca Sparkman of the Internal Revenue Service-Criminal Investigation have scheduled a news conference after the court appearances.
